Description

Leidos is looking for an Agile Product Owner to join our team responsible for the integration, operations, and sustainment of various operational and in-development systems.

This position will manage a team made up of devops engineers, software developers, configuration managers, and cybersecurity engineers tasked to deliver the next generation of Geospatial Intelligence technologies to our customer.

A successful candidate will have experience with Agile methodologies and the various tools necessary to run agile teams, as well as the ability to participate in release planning events, daily scrums, and other technical discussions to deliver products that meet customer requirements.

The effort will harness GOTS, COTS and Custom technologies to deliver advanced production and dissemination capabilities using desktop, web and cloud technologies.

Primary Responsibilities :

  • Drive product delivery through keen understanding of the customer, mission, and product requirements
  • Develop the product team roadmap (and supplemental activity schedules) and provide team support to fulfill team commitments and deliverables
  • Plan and prioritize epics, features, stories, and bugs
  • Proven ability to write technical tasks with business value for the customer
  • Help define, document, and track the completion of Epics, Stories, Tasks, and Bugs
  • Communicate with other product owners, scrum masters, program leadership, customers, and development teams to overcome obstacles, align tasks, fulfill requirements, and enhance team and product value
  • Lead and support agile ceremonies / meetings such as daily scrum, retrospectives, and program increment planning
  • Develops and proposes new ideas regarding technical solutions and processes
  • Create and update written briefings and reports to program and customer leadership.
  • Effectively and regularly communicates with key internal and external stakeholders (often regarding critical / high priority issues)
  • Consult with team members and customers to create and refine the product backlog.
